Why wont it let me "use black color" in my patterns?! How? I need black in my alpha I'm trying to post.

You can use #333333 or #383838 as replacement for black. The reason you can't use actual black is that because of the darkness it's difficult to see the knots when you just look at the preview of the pattern.

@knottingav you can only create patterns on the website as far as i know. just search braceletbook.com and sign into your account that you’re on right now. then you can go over to the thing on the orange bar that has your profile. if you hover the cursor on a computer then there are a few options. one of them says create patterns and then from there you can make an alpha or normal pattern. alphas are made on a grid like pixel art and for normals or shaped you have to put in the exact knots for each row. alphas are simpler for beginners to create.

i have a question how do u submit a pattern that u have made?
halokiwi
Moderator
halokiwi
4 years, 5 months ago by halokiwi
@AlexisHehe are you in the generator or do you need help finding the generator?

Here is how you can get to the generator: you need to be on the website, not the app. On a computer you hover over your username on the top right, on a phone you click on it. Then you select “create patterns” in the drop-down menu. Then you can choose if you want to create a normal or alpha pattern.

If you are in the generator, are you designing a normal pattern or an alpha?

If you want to submit an alpha pattern you have to be in "alpha". If you are currently in "draw alpha" make sure to click "save" before going to "alpha".

In order for a pattern to be accepted you have to add at least four keywords that describe the pattern. Think about what keywords you would search for if you wanted to search for a pattern like the one you want to submit.

To be able to submit a pattern you have to click the box where it says "share rights" and then you can click submit.
